This Burmese amber specimen contains a finely preserved spider suspended within rich, golden Cretaceous resin. The spider’s body and extended legs are clearly visible, offering a detailed and captivating glimpse into prehistoric arachnid life nearly 100 million years ago. The clarity of the amber highlights the delicate anatomical features, allowing light to illuminate the natural positioning and intricate form of the specimen. This piece combines scientific significance with striking visual appeal, making it a desirable addition to any amber or fossil collection.
Details
• Approximately 100 million years old
• Origin: Hukawng Valley, Burma
• Period: Cretaceous amber, time of the dinosaurs
• Inclusions: Spider
